I like the color dragon red. Its not a paint color. Not that I know of. Its a pottery color. I take a pottery class. Handbuilt stuff, not wheel thrown. Yesterday I brought home some stuff I’ve not been able to get in to pick up for awhile.



This bowl is a coil project we did in class. I did mine in a pasta strainer for that side texture you see. It’s a fairly large size bowl. I had to let it dry extra slow. Not just out on the shelf. So it wouldn’t crack.



I did the sides unevenly on purpose. Well, there was really no way I could get them even, even if I had tried. So I didn’t try. I chose to go uneven and in a more random pattern. I think the bowl came out well.

By now you might have noticed I have a thing for spirals.



I am fascinated by them in all their forms.



So what does a spiral mean? The definition of a spiral is this :
  Winding or circling round a center or pole and gradually receding from it; as, the spiral curve of a watch spring.
Or, more fancy, A plane curve, not reentrant, described by a point, called the generatrix, moving along a straight line according to a mathematical law, while the line is revolving about a fixed point called the pole. Cf. Helix.




Our galaxy is a spiral



The spiral also shows up in nature. Tornadoes, hurricanes, snails, the pattern of sunflower seeds, right down to the shape or our DNA.
